Wimmer, McRae Lead UMW Women's Basketball Past Roanoke, 75-41

Box Score

Senior Katie Wimmer (Vienna, Va., James Madison) scored 17 points and senior Jenna McRae (Springfield, Va., Annandale) added 14 to lead the University of Mary Washington women's basketball team to a 75-41 win over Roanoke College in the Randolph-Macon College Tipoff tournament on Friday in Ashland. The Eagles improve to 2-0 on the year.

The Eagles raced out to a 40-14 lead at halftime, and never looked back. UMW shot 29-60 from the floor (48%), while limiting Roanoke to 11 field goals and 22% shooting. The Eagles won the rebounding battle, 41-31.

Wimmer shot 6-11 from the floor, while McRae went 5-9. Sophomore Aby Diop (Springfield, Va., Annandale) had nine points and rebounds for the Eagles. Roanoke was led by Paxton Gwin's 14 points.

Mary Washington will be back in action on Saturday when they visit Randolph-Macon at 4:00 p.m.
